HANDOVER — Commission Scheme Revision

To the incoming director: the revised scheme goes live on the 1st. Key changes: accelerators start at 110% of quota, not 100%; multi-year Quillstone deals pay out over term, not upfront; clawbacks extend to nine months. Reps were briefed last week — expect pushback from the Ashgrove pod. Payroll mapping is done; Tomas owns the calculator. Disputes route through RevOps, not you. One outstanding item: the enterprise override rate is unresolved. Background for that decision sits below.

internal memo for kahif-kawig: Project Fravan slips by two quarters because of the tooling delay.

## Environments & Pinning

Quick orientation for new folks on Tindergrove: every environment pins dependencies to exact versions — no ranges, no floating tags, ever. Staging bumps weekly, prod only after a soak. If a pin breaks, file a ticket rather than loosening it. Each environment boots with the values listed here.

config for bafog-kafog:
wenix:
  log_level: debug
  metrics_host: metrics.wenix.zemvarlabs.internal
  pin: 3500
  pool_size: 16

Load test: Cartwright checkout flow

Scope: checkout service only. Synthetic traffic via the Stormgate harness, ramping to 400 rps over 20 minutes. Test accounts use sandbox payment tokens; no real card data enters the system at any point. Rate limiting stays enabled — we are measuring behavior under throttling, not bypassing it. Fraud checks run in shadow mode. Abort if error rate exceeds 2% for 60 seconds. The harness runs with the configuration below.

deployment values, yahag-tawef:
ZORWYN_HOST=zorwyn.tolvaqlabs.internal
ZORWYN_PORT=9300